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

voodoo

Новачок
  
  • Публікації

    37
  • З нами

  • Відвідування

Повідомлення, опубліковані користувачем voodoo

  1. Сделал добавив в модель производителя:

    $sql .= " AND EXISTS (SELECT 1 FROM " . DB_PREFIX . "product p WHERE p.manufacturer_id = m.manufacturer_id AND p.status = '1' AND EXISTS (SELECT 1 FROM " . DB_PREFIX . "product_to_store p2s WHERE p.product_id = p2s.product_id AND p2s.store_id = '" . (int)$this->config->get('config_store_id') . "'))";

    Вроде все работает шустро, 150 производителей, 2000 товаров. Гуру подскажите, сильно это коряво и будет ли сильно грузить?

  2. Я так понимаю отправление ссылки не происходит? Что означает вот такой лог:

    Цитата

    2022-04-05 14:14:48 - Send: Array
    (
        [0] => https://misocosmetics.com.ua/dlya_lica/tonizirovanie/toner-s-bifidobakteriyami-ma-nyo-bifida-biome-ampoule-toner-300-ml
    )

    2022-04-05 14:14:48 - Send: Array
    (
        [response-url-0] => stdClass Object
            (
                [error] => stdClass Object
                    (
                        [code] => 403
                        [message] => Permission denied. Failed to verify the URL ownership.
                        [errors] => Array
                            (
                                [0] => stdClass Object
                                    (
                                        [message] => Permission denied. Failed to verify the URL ownership.
                                        [domain] => global
                                        [reason] => forbidden
                                    )

                            )

                        [status] => PERMISSION_DENIED
                    )

            )

    )

     

  3. При обновлении происходит изменение колонки date_modified в таблице бд oc_product, в которую устанавливается дата обновления. Эта же колонка используется в заголовке last-modified, на который ориентируются поисковые боты. Получается не очень хорошо, что боты постоянно считают, что все товары обновлены, что замедляет индексацию сайта. Я так понимаю это АОП меняет дату, может есть смысл добавить какую то проверку на изменение информации содержащейся в продукте и если изменилась, то менять дату?

  4. Ну как я понимаю, с указанными настройками (set-filter to base отключен) noindex-sort_lim не должен добавлять метатег роботс для базы (именно на страницах сортировки категорий, производителя, акций). Но в в хеаде появляется вот так:

    <meta name="keywords" content>

    <meta name="robots" content="noindex, nofollow">

     Если снять галочку с noindex-sort_lim и больше ничего не менять, тег роботс и keywords пропадает.

  5. При вот таких настройках, noindex-sort_lim все равно работает для базы (категории, производители, акции).

    noindex-page работает только при выставленной set-filter to base, а вот noindex-sort_lim не обращает на set-filter to base внимание. С чем может быть связано? Метатег keywords у меня не заполнен и не выводится в базе на этих страницах.

    Снимок.PNG

  6. Было бы удобно:

    1. Товары с количеством 0 или меньше в конец перечня

    2. В настройках модуля выбрать статусы товаров для отображения вообще. Есть специфические статусы, как то Архив, Ожидание поставки и т.д., которые не нужны в отображении.

     

  7. В 03.05.2020 в 22:35, funjoy сказал:

    Модулем доволен как слон - очень быстрый, просто реактивный подбор товара! Простая настройка, полезность атрибутов для вебмастеров, можно гибко настроить вывод товаров. Спасибо Автору данного модуля)

     

    С сортировкой почему-то не получается:

    сделал как подсказали в теме (прикрепил), но почему- то модуль так не хочет делать, хотя другие разделы категории работают по принципу: товары, которых нет - в конец

    вот пример категории где все в порядке - https://веселаярадость.рф/игрушки-для-мальчиков/танки/

    и вот пример под выборку модуля - https://веселаярадость.рф/index.php?route=extension/module/mmfilter_products/category&attribute_0=мальчику&attribute_id_0=78&attribute_1=14-99 лет&attribute_id_1=76&row=2&module_id=57 - апокалипсис получается :unsure:

    может все таки в модуле нужно что-то дописать, подправить? 

     

    Уважаемые вебмастера и автор модуля - подскажите как привести в порядок сортировку в данном модуле

     

    P.s. - модификаторы обновлены, кэш почищен, браузера кэш тоже, модуль включал/выключал не помогает

     

     

    Тоже интересен этот вопрос. Как я понимаю, для того что бы реализовать сортировку, надо редактировать зашифрованный файл. Есть может какие другие варианты?

  8. Здравствуйте. Обновился на 9.2. Возможно что-то сделал не так при обновлении, но сейчас если запустить прайс по ссылке на форму поставдщика, после обработки в шапке сайта выдает ошибку: 

    Цитата

    Notice: Undefined offset: 0 in /home/misocosm/misocosmetics.com.ua/www/admin/model/catalog/suppler.php on line 19026Notice: Undefined offset: 0 in /home/misocosm/misocosmetics.com.ua/www/admin/model/catalog/suppler.php on line 19027

     

    В самом файле suppler.php по этим строкам

    $query = $this->db->query("SELECT * FROM " . DB_PREFIX . "suppler_cron WHERE `form_id` = '" . $form_id . "' and `cmd` = '" . 4 . "'");
    		$_SESSION["user_name"] = $query->rows[0]['ftp_name']; 
    		$_SESSION["user_pass"] = $query->rows[0]['ftp_pass'];

    Вот строка 19026 где юзер нейм, 19027 где юзер пасс. 

     

    П.С. Не актуально, решилось пересохранением формы. Текст оставил, может кому полезно будет.

  9. Здравствуйте. Пару вопросов:

    1. Купил модуль, сейчас разбираюсь на тестовой версии сайта. Столкнулся с такой проблемой.

    Просле перехода на вкладку СЕО_УРЛ или далее, выскакивает окошко с информацией, что вы переходите на другую вкладку, и предлагает сохранить изменения. При нажатии сохранить или же если просто сохранить с помощью иконки выдает такую ошибку:

    Цитата

     ERROR!!! code: 4, status: 200, textStatus: parsererror, "responseText:" Warning: fileperms(): stat failed for /home/misocosm/misocosmetics.com.ua/test/catalog/view/theme/default/stylesheet/filter_vier/other/main_set.css in /home/misocosm/misocosmetics.com.ua/test/admin/controller/extension/module/filter_vier.php on line 0Warning: chmod(): No such file or directory in /home/misocosm/misocosmetics.com.ua/test/admin/controller/extension/module/filter_vier.php on line 0{"succ":"saves... \u0417\u0430\u043f\u0438\u0441\u0430\u043d\u044b \u041e\u043f\u0438\u0441\u0430\u043d\u0438\u044f \u0432 \u0411\u0414 scroll_images; \u041f\u043e\u043b\u044c\u0437\u043e\u0432\u0430\u0442\u0435\u043b\u044c\u0441\u043a\u0438\u0439 \u0441\u0442\u0438\u043b\u044c \u0437\u0430\u043f\u0438\u0441\u0430\u043d!; ","error_warning":" No read \/home\/misocosm\/misocosmetics.com.ua\/test\/catalog\/view\/theme\/default\/stylesheet\/filter_vier\/other\/main_set.css (0)<\/b>;"}

    При этом файла main_set.css не существует в архиве с модулем вообще.

     

    2. Тоже интересует момент работы с модулем Автоматическая обработка прайс листов. У меня атрибуты обновляются с помощью АОП. Как данный фильтр работает с атрибутами, в случае изменения атрибутов он изменяет фильтры автоматически, или это делается какой то настройкой в модуле. Ну к примеру я поставил фильтр, через неделю поменял атрибуты, как в этом случае актуализировать это в фильтре?

  10. Настроил автообновление по крону из гугл-таблиц. В гугл таблице сделал размещение в интернете в формате CSV, включил автообновление при изменении. Ссылку скормил крону. АОП работает отлично, все обновляет как часы, отчеты приходят и т.д.

    Но столкнулся с такой проблемой. Я не использую прайсы поставщиков, использую собственную таблицу, где автоматически (с помощью скриптов и гугл формул) расчитывается количество товара. Так вот, оказывается гугл запускает обработку формул только при открытии таблиц в браузере кем либо (и возможно только при внесении изменений вручную). После этого обновляются все расчеты и обновляется размещенный в интернете файл CSV. Получается такая ситуация: АОП обновляет раз в час, таблицы открыл утром, потом до вечера не открывал. За день приходят заказы, количество меняется, но поскольку гугл таблицы не открывались АОП весь день обновляет утреннюю версию прайса.

    Кто нибудь решал подобную проблему? Как можно заставить гугл таблицы работать в фоновом режиме на стороне гугла? (про настройку триггеров для скриптов я знаю, вот только полностью все на скрипты не перевести)

  11. Здравствуйте, модуль подтягивает города в каком-то формате не новопочтовском. То есть город выглядит так: "м. Киев, Киевский район, Киевская область", в то время как в новой почте просто Киев. Возможно ли сделать так, что бы подтягивался именно новопочтовский вариант города?

  12. Разобрался, настроил. Учитывая эту особенность Вашего модуля было бы не плохо в следующих обновлениях (если они планируются) в файле abstract_additional_page_controller.class.php комментариями отметить логику работы и описание что делает какая функция, это упростит самостоятельное добавление нужных данных.

  13. 5 часов назад, Rassol2 сказал:

    Здравствуйте.
    По поводу сортировки ничего не скажу, а вот срок действия акции можно поменять через инструменты. там есть действие задать время акции.

    Это я знаю, мне нужно что бы при изначальном импорте делало. Догадываюсь, что это можно сделать в коде модуля, но там такая библия, что найти нужное очень тяжело.

  14. Подскажите, есть ли возможность изменить порядок сортировки и срок акций при импорте? В настройках можно проставлять только акционные цены для груп покупателей, что автоматически добавляет к товару акцию с порядком сортировки 1 и сроком 10 дней. Нужно что бы добавляло бессрочно и порядок сортировки 10 к примеру, что бы не перебивать другие акции созданные с помощью сторонних модулей или вручную.

  15. Опять возникли проблемы в работе Вашего модуля совместно со сторонними. Конкретно в данном случае с модулем спецпредложений, который выводит таймер на товарах. Я правильно понимаю, что для адаптации сторонних модулей в abstract_additional_page_controller.class.php я должен вручную внести все модификации которые сторонний модуль добавляет в special.php?

  16. Как модуль учитывает завершенный заказ? Не вижу в настройках выбор статуса по которому заказ считается завершенным. И еще подскажите, если выполняются оба условия для накопительной скидки и скидки от суммы текущего заказа, какая из них применяется или они сумируются?

  17. Подскажите, у меня используется поле UPC, ISBN, EAN для вывода стикеров. После того как в прайсе заполнил колонки из которых импортируются данные, все добавилось к товарам и стикеры выводятся. Но при удалении в прайсе данных полей для товара, АОП не удаляет их в товарах на сайте. Как я понимаю он не очищает существующее значение на сайте, если в прайсе пустая ячейка. Возможно ли каким либо образом настроить что бы эти поля очищались при отсутсвии их в прайсе?

×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.